A collection of ten George III or Regency needlework pictures, late 18th / early 19th century

All worked with chenille or silk threads on silk backgrounds and most with giltwood frames, comprising a round picture depicting a shepherdess crafting a floral wreath; two oval pictures depicting ladies harvesting crops; a pair of round pictures heightened with painted paper faces and appendages, the first depicting a lady harvesting flowers, the second depicting a mourner next to Werter's tomb; an oval picture of a be-ribboned floral bouquet; a small oval picture depicting a flower basket, housed in rectangular burlwood frame; a small pair of oval pictures depicting rural townscapes; and a small oval picture depicting a lakeside dwelling with docked boat, the backboard inscribed and dated, "...Pinckney/ 1806."

11 in. x 9 1/2 in. (floral bouquet, sight), 13 1/4 in. x 11 3/4 in. (floral bouquet, framed)
